COLLEGE ADVISORY FOR SENIORS
All seniors are enrolled in a once-a-week College Advisory course that meets during the 7th period. The College Counselors, Mrs. Lopez & Mrs. Sciacca, are the instructors. Starting the first full week of school, a different aspect of the college application and admission process will be covered each week. Students will be provided essential and timely information and instructions about selecting colleges and completing applications.

COLLEGE REP VISITS
Seniors are encouraged to sign up for College Rep Visits to learn more about their college options. Often the representative visiting is also responsible for reviewing applications from our students. It is a valuable opportunity to meet these representatives, hear their presentations, and be able to ask questions. The visits are hosted primarily in the months of August through October. Students can view a calendar of visits and sign up/register in SCOIR. A weekly list and reminders are posted in Schoology.
